1 Pictorial Markings

2 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Fragile The contents of the package are fragile and must be handled with care. Use no hooks Hooks must be used when handling this package.

3 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Top This indicates the correct, upright position of the package. Keep away from heat The package should be protected from heat.

4 Protect from radioactive sources
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Protect from radioactive sources The contents of the package can be degraded or rendered useless as a result of radioactivity. Keep dry The package must be kept in a dry environment.

5 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Center of gravity This indicates the center of gravity of a package that is to be handled as a single unit. Do not roll The package must not be rolled.

6 Do not use forklift truck here
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function No hand truck here Hand trucks must not be used on this side to handle the package. Do not use forklift truck here The package must not be handled using forklift trucks.

7 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Clamp here Clamps must be applied to the sides indicated to handle the package. Do not clamp here Clamps must not be applied to the sides indicated to handle the package.

8 Stacking weight limitation
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Stacking weight limitation This indicates the maximum stacking load for packages. Stacking limitation This indicates maximum number of packages that may be stacked, where n stands for the number of permitted packages.

9 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Do not stack Stacking of the packages is not permitted and loads should not be placed on the package. Sling here Slinging equipment must be applied as shown in order to lift the package.

10 Permitted temperature range Electrostatic sensitive device
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Permitted temperature range This indicates the temperature range within which the package must be stored and handled. Electrostatic sensitive device Contact with packages bearing this symbol should be avoided at low levels of relative humidity, especially if insulating footwear is being worn or the ground/floor is nonconductive. Low levels of relative humidity must be expected on hot, dry summer days and very cold winter days.

11 Meaning of the symbol Symbol Function Do not destroy barrier
A barrier layer, which is impermeable to water vapor and contains desiccants for corrosion protection, is located beneath the outer packaging. This protection will be ineffective if the barrier layer is damaged.  Tear/ Open here This symbol is intended only for the recipient.
